North Carolina S781 introduces a tax credit for businesses that cover wages for employee health insurance premiums. Eligible businesses can claim a credit of up to $400 per qualifying employee, with an aggregate limit of $5 million annually. The Department of Revenue reviews applications on a first-come, first-served basis, and must report annually to the Joint Legislative Committee on Governmental Operations. The credit applies to taxable years starting from January 1, 2026.
